The global Data Center Rear Door Heat Exchanger market size is expected to reach $ 3669 million by 2032, rising at a market growth of 17.9% CAGR during the forecast period (2026-2032).

In 2025, global Data Center Rear Door Heat Exchanger production reached approximately 200,000 units, with an average global market price of around USD 5,600 per unit.

The gross profit margin of major companies in the industry is between 22.68%?40.52%.

In 2025, the global production capacity of Data Center Rear Door Heat Exchanger was approximately 263,158 units.

Data Center Rear Door Heat Exchanger is a rack-mounted cooling device installed on the rear side of server cabinets to remove heat from exhaust air before it enters the data hall. It uses liquid-cooled coils, fans, sensors and control systems to reduce hot aisle temperature and improve cooling efficiency. The product is used in high-density data centers, enterprise server rooms, telecom rooms, AI computing facilities and high-performance computing centers. The market includes passive and active rear door heat exchangers, but excludes cold plates, immersion cooling tanks and full room-level cooling systems.

The industry chain includes copper tubes, aluminum fins, stainless steel frames, heat exchange coils, fans, valves, hoses, quick connectors, sensors, controllers and leak detection devices. Midstream production covers coil fabrication, frame assembly, hydraulic testing, airflow design, control integration, leak testing, performance testing and packaging. Downstream demand comes from cloud data centers, AI computing rooms, enterprise facilities, telecom rooms and high-performance computing centers. Growth is driven by rack power density, cooling retrofit demand, data center energy saving and expansion of liquid-assisted cooling solutions.
